  • Centralized Management
    BatchPatch provides a centralized interface to manage and deploy updates across multiple systems, which saves time and reduces the complexity involved in patch management.
  • Ease of Use
    The tool is designed with a user-friendly interface, making it accessible for IT administrators to quickly learn and use without extensive training.
  • Scheduling Flexibility
    BatchPatch allows users to schedule patches, updates, and deployments at convenient times, minimizing disruptions to business operations.
  • Cost-Effective
    As a one-time purchase software, BatchPatch can be more cost-effective compared to other subscription-based patch management tools.
  • Offline Update Support
    The tool supports deploying updates in offline environments, which is beneficial for networks with limited or no internet access.

Possible disadvantages

  • Limited Platform Support
    BatchPatch is primarily focused on Windows systems, which may not be suitable for environments with diverse operating systems.
  • No Native Cloud Integration
    The software lacks native cloud integration, which might limit its utility for organizations moving towards cloud-based infrastructures.
  • Scalability Challenges
    While effective for small to medium-sized networks, BatchPatch may encounter performance issues in larger, enterprise-level environments.
  • Lack of Advanced Reporting
    The tool does not provide as comprehensive reporting features as some competitors, possibly limiting insights into patch compliance and system status.
  • Manual Setup Required
    Initial configuration can be time-consuming as BatchPatch requires manual setup and configuration on each target machine.
